Cole warns duo to behave on 'X Factor'

Cheryl Cole has warned Katie Waissel and Cher Lloyd to show the public their "softer sides".

The 'X Factor' judge - who mentors the pair, alongside Rebecca Ferguson and Treyc Cohen in the Girls category - has apparently told them they need to be on their best behaviour to avoid being booted from the show tomorrow.

The Daily Mirror claims she said: "The public needs to warm to you. You both need to show them a softer side."

This comes amid reports the girls are causing tension backstage with their demands and tantrums.

It has been reported the other contestants in the competition have been keeping their distance from the pair, with some refusing to talk to them.

After spotting the two contestants trying on their outfits for this evening's live show, the fellow wannabes were furious at claims TV bosses had spent more on their glamorous stage clothes.

One source told The Sun newspaper: "People couldn't believe how amazing they looked and were loudly moaning. But most people just ignored the two of them and refused to speak to them."

Tensions also rose over rehearsal time, with some performers checking their watches to ensure their rivals didn't go over their 15-20 minute rehearsal slot with singing coaches and creative director Brian Friedman.

A source said: "It was ridiculous how petty some people were being.

"They'll all be rushing out to buy stopwatches next week."

Meanwhile, Katie admits to will need to sing "from the heart" tonight to avoid landing in the bottom three again in tomorrow's results show.

She said: "I really want to just go out and there and sing from my heart and soul - and hopefully people will see that this weekend."
